The Powder River Bridge is a National Registered Historic Place located in Terry, Montana. It was added to the Register on January 4, 2010. It is a steel truss style bridge built in 1946.[2] The bridge is 633 feet in length consisting of a 203-foot main truss span and two 163-foot truss spans.
